在定义中使用require

时间:2017-06-11 10:10:08

标签: php require

我正在尝试使用require将表放在define

   define('ITEM1','text '.require('../../targetfile.php').' More text';

这个想法是在每个定义中提供一个需要的表,而不必每次都复制和粘贴它。

我尝试了各种各样的东西,但没有任何效果,我希望你可以,提前谢谢。

targetfile.php将包含一个大表

1 个答案:

答案 0 :(得分:0)

require()包含并评估指定的文件。它会在失败时停止执行。成功后,它将返回1

你能做到这一点:

file1.php:

$myTable = '.....';

file2.php:

require('file1.php');
define('ITEM1','text '.$myTable.' More text');

define()可以使用变量,因为它在运行时创建常量。